Travel behavior in the US has changed more in the past few years than at any time in living memory.

While some travel patterns have returned to normal since the COVID-19 pandemic, others have not. Traffic volumes, transit ridership, and broader commuting habits still differ significantly from pre-pandemic levels.

In 2024, the Institute of Transportation Engineers (ITE) formed a task force to analyze this shift. Ian Barnes of Fehr & Peers contributed to that research and co-wrote an article for ITE Journal sharing the group’s findings.

A Design Win for Seattle Sidewalks

A Design Win for Seattle Sidewalks

Micromobility is growing, but when scooters and bikes have nowhere obvious to park, sidewalks suffer. Seattle tackled this with quick-build corrals, using simple outlines to guide parking right away, then upgrading to durable markings and in-street designs. Evacuation Impact Assessment Checklist

Evacuation Impact Assessment Checklist

Recent California decisions and the Attorney General’s 2022 guidance have raised expectations for how CEQA documents address evacuation. Our Evacuation Impact Assessment Checklist is a qualitative analysis tool that helps teams organize evidence, screen for potential impacts, and reach a defensible conclusion faster, so time and effort can shift from extensive quantification to identifying mitigation and evacuation improvements.
